The Rise of CNC Cutting Machines in Modern Industry

The manufacturing industry has undergone a radical transformation with the adoption of CNC technology in manufacturing. CNC stands for Computer Numerical Control, which is the controlled operation of machines by computers with great accuracy and repeatability. The introduction of CNC cutting machines has minimized human error, enhanced production speeds, and allowed industries to maintain tight tolerances on components.

Metal, wood, plastic, composites, and other materials can all be sliced by these automated cutting devices Their ability to interpret CAD files and convert them into precise physical parts is what makes them ideal for precision manufacturing.

What Makes CNC Cutting Machines So Precise?

At the core of every CNC cutting machine lies a software-based control system that dictates every movement and cut. This software ensures that operations are consistent, repeatable, and tailored to micrometer-level tolerances. Accuracy in manufacturing is critical, especially in sectors where a minor error could result in component failure. High-precision cutting tools used in CNC machines maintain consistency throughout long production runs, ensuring each piece is identical to the last. Furthermore, advanced cutting equipment is equipped with sensors and feedback systems that adjust operations in real-time. This ensures that each cut remains accurate, even if conditions like material thickness or tool wear change.

Applications of CNC Cutting Machines Across Industries

Because of their adaptability and scalability, CNC cutting machines are used in many different industries:

  • Automotive: For cutting engine components, panels, and gears
  • Aerospace: Precision is critical in wing parts, turbine blades, and interior components
  • Construction: For custom metal brackets and frameworks
  • Medical Devices: Tiny and accurate cuts are necessary for surgical instruments
  • Furniture and Woodworking: Crafting fine, intricate wooden patterns

These industries rely on industrial CNC solutions to meet production demands with flawless output.

Advanced Cutting Equipment: The Backbone of Smart Factories

The rise of smart manufacturing or Industry 4.0 has made advanced cutting equipment the heart of modern production. These machines are often network-connected, enabling predictive maintenance, remote monitoring, and integration with other smart systems.

AI-assisted CNC cutting machines can even optimize paths and speeds dynamically for better efficiency. With these capabilities, factories not only achieve better accuracy in manufacturing, but they also improve energy efficiency and reduce environmental impact.
